Sfoglia il codice sorgente

我的任务组件样式优化

DESKTOP-6LTVLN7\Liumouren 2 anni fa
parent
commit
45adb3b69a
2 ha cambiato i file con 14 aggiunte e 13 eliminazioni
  1. 4 1
      src/assets/global.css
  2. 10 12
      src/components/common/BottomForm/MyMission.vue

+ 4 - 1
src/assets/global.css

@@ -119,7 +119,7 @@
   box-sizing: border-box;
 }
 .el-dialog__title,.el-message-box__title {
-  color: #00aaff;
+  color: #FFFFFF;
 }
 .el-form-item__label,
 .el-message-box__message {
@@ -162,4 +162,7 @@
 }
 .el-table thead{
   color: #FFFFFF;
+}
+.el-table__fixed{
+  height: 0;
 }

+ 10 - 12
src/components/common/BottomForm/MyMission.vue

@@ -25,14 +25,19 @@
       </el-form-item>
     </el-form>
     <el-table :data="tableData" style="width: 100%" height="50vh" stripe>
-      <el-table-column fixed prop="taskId" label="任务编号"> </el-table-column>
+      <el-table-column type="index" width="50"> </el-table-column>
+      <el-table-column prop="taskId" label="任务编号"> </el-table-column>
       <el-table-column prop="taskName" label="任务名称"> </el-table-column>
       <el-table-column prop="createDate" label="创建时间"> </el-table-column>
-      <el-table-column prop="state" label="状态"> </el-table-column>
+      <el-table-column prop="state" label="状态">
+        <template slot-scope="scope">
+          <el-tag :type="scope.row.state === '已审核' ? 'success' : 'info'" disable-transitions>{{ scope.row.state }}</el-tag>
+        </template>
+      </el-table-column>
       <el-table-column prop="taskType" label="任务类型"> </el-table-column>
       <el-table-column fixed="right" label="操作">
         <template slot-scope="scope">
-          <el-button @click.native.prevent="ToView(scope.$index, tableData)" type="text" size="small"> 查看 </el-button>
+          <el-button size="mini" icon="el-icon-search" @click="ToView(scope.$index, tableData)">查看</el-button>
         </template>
       </el-table-column>
     </el-table>
@@ -144,14 +149,7 @@ export default {
           createDate: "2016-05-03",
           taskName: "任务名称",
           taskId: "任务编号",
-          state: "已审核",
-          taskType: "土地资源"
-        },
-        {
-          createDate: "2016-05-03",
-          taskName: "任务名称",
-          taskId: "任务编号",
-          state: "已审核",
+          state: "未审核",
           taskType: "土地资源"
         },
         {
@@ -254,7 +252,7 @@ export default {
     },
     // 查看
     ToView(index, rows) {
-      console.log(rows,index);
+      console.log(rows, index);
     },
     // 当用户点击svg底座时,切换底部菜单显示隐藏状态。
     changeShowBottomMenusStatus() {